We are rapidly intersecting the present and the future to connect, protect, explore, and inspire - one innovative idea at a time.Boeing Defense, Space & Security (BDS) is seeking associate strength (P2) engineers for multiple advanced air vehicle proprietary programs located at our St. Louis site. As a member of this team, you will be responsible for the structural performance and structural integrity of air vehicle components.Position Responsibilities:

  • Performs basic structural analysis using well defined analysis tools to develop the structural environment, characteristics and performance.
  • Supports test execution and analyzes/reports test results to validate and verify systems and components meet requirements and specifications.
  • Defines and documents certification and test results to substantiate for customers and regulatory agencies that requirements are satisfied.
  • Supports in-service products by investigating failures and analyzing improvements.
  • Works under general supervision.

For Special Program Access requiring ship.Basic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's Degree or higher from an accredited course of study in engineering, computer science, mathematics, physics or chemistry.
  • 1+ years of experience working with aircraft stress analysis/structural analysis
Preferred/Desired Job Skills/Qualifications:
  • 1+ years of experience using NASTRAN/PATRAN or similar FEM software to perform structural analysis on aircraft or space structures.
  • 1+ years of experience with Military Air Vehicle Platform Structure or Sub-System definition and analysis.
  • 1+ years of experience with design/analysis of metallic and composite structure.
  • Background utilizing classical hand analysis as well as finite element methods and tools
  • Experience collaborating across multi-functional teams
  • Experience with aircraft structural analysis and composite materials.
